Websense offers to buy rival SurfControl Websense offers to buy rival SurfControl

April 27, 2007 | Author: Joris Evers.
San Diego-based Websense said on Thursday it had offered to buy U.K.-based rival SurfControl in a deal valued at about $400 million in cash. Both companies sell products designed to protect organizations from Internet threats, such as Web sites that attempt to install malicious software.

DoubleClick: We don't own consumer data DoubleClick: We don't own consumer data

April 21, 2007 | Author: Stefanie Olsen.
Following Google's announcement to buy DoubleClick for $3.1 billion, the search giant told the L.A. Times that it hopes to eventually merge the non-personally identifiable information from its own servers and those of the ad-serving giant DoubleClick. That way, Google would be able to better target ads to Web surfers, according to the search company.

Microsoft sued for patent infringement Microsoft sued for patent infringement

April 21, 2007 | Author: Ina Fried.
Fort Worth, Texas-based Vertical Computer Systems said Friday that it has filed a patent infringement suit against Microsoft. Vertical filed its suit Wednesday in U.S. District Court in Texas, claiming Microsoft's .Net technology infringes on its patent.

More money flows to CIGS: $79 mil to Solyndra More money flows to CIGS: $79 mil to Solyndra

April 6, 2007 | Author: Michael Kanellos.
Solyndra, a somewhat secretive developer of solar cells made from copper indium gallium selenium, or CIGS, has raised $79 million, according to London-based clean tech industry analyst New Energy Finance. Investors include CMEA Ventures and Redpoint Ventures.
